Output 285b2390eae42391f463c602efb881c2fc031c408babf0c9a44a62561d94ff69:2

value
299553685
script pubkey
OP_0 OP_PUSHBYTES_20 78e803da28875000bb8a20efcade8b0e6a396dc0
address
bc1q0r5q8k3gsagqpwu2yrhu4h5tpe4rjmwqve0nay
transaction
285b2390eae42391f463c602efb881c2fc031c408babf0c9a44a62561d94ff69
spent
true